practice: For General Gastroenterologists: - Diagnosing and
managing a broad range of gastrointestinal conditions. - Performing
routine endoscopic procedures, including colonoscopies and upper
endoscopies. - Providing patient education, disease prevention
guidance, and health maintenance support. For Gastroenterologists
with Advanced Skills: - Diagnosing and managing complex
gastrointestinal conditions using advanced diagnostic and
therapeutic techniques. - Performing ERCP procedures to address
disorders of the bile ducts, pancreas, and gallbladder. - Utilizing
EUS examinations to diagnose and stage gastrointestinal tumors and
manage pancreatic and biliary disorders. - Collaborate with
interdisciplinary teams to provide comprehensive care and
coordinate multi-disciplinary treatment plans. Qualifications: What
you’ll need as a Gastroenterologist. - Graduate from an accredited
Medical School. - Active New York Medical License. - Board
Certified or Board Eligible Gastroenterologist. - For Advanced GI:
Subspecialty training in Advanced Endoscopy, including ERCP and
